Transaction f3db2808c870053e9631d0a561e02c651a1de898500eb68851f79beac6febf70
1 Input
1 Output
-
f3db2808c870053e9631d0a561e02c651a1de898500eb68851f79beac6febf70:0
- value
- 4400204
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2fb1a3e027544a6018e4269ee6a6fd31dc1e198b OP_EQUALVERIFY OP_CHECKSIG
- address
- 15MBZfpSCwwph16JKdyVJbWgF3yTS9jQAA